研究概览

简要总结

This study aim to determine the feasibility of using a virtual reality (VR) headset (HTC Vive) to test the visual field. The VR headset test will be compared to a conventional visual field test, using the Humphrey Field Analyzer. The investigators will include 10 healthy patients without visual field defect, 10 patients with early glaucomatous visual field defect, and 10 patients with advanced visual field defect. Each patient will perform the conventional test twice and the VR headset test 4 times, divided in 3 visits within a 2 month period. The results of the tests (sensitivity thresholds) will be compared. The investigators hypothesize that the results of the conventional and VR tests will be similar.

入排标准

年龄范围
18 Years 至 —(Adult, Older Adult)
性别
All
接受健康志愿者

入选标准

  • Previous visual field test with Humphrey Field Analyzer indicating normal field, early glaucomatous field damage, or advanced glaucomatous field damage, according to Canadian Glaucoma Society Guidelines.
  • Ability to understand and consent to the study.

排除标准

  • Presence of non-glaucomatous pathology that could influence the visual field test, such as media opacities.
  • Previous intraocular surgery less than 6 months from inclusion.
  • Difficulty to execute a reliable visual field test.
  • Potential contra-indications to use of virtual reality headset, including: anxiety disorder, pregnancy, seizure disorder, cardiac pacemaker or other implantable device, severe vertigo or balance disturbance.

结局指标

主要结局

Visual field differential light sensitivity threshold

时间窗: Three weeks

Comparison of differential light sensitivity threshold estimated with the Humphrey Field Analyzer and the Virtual Reality headset

次要结局

  • Reproducibility of sensitivity values(Three weeks)
